PHPA Annual Meeting of Player Representatives 2013 Meeting Minutes Tuesday, June 18, 2013 Attendees Executive Committee, Player Representatives, PHPA Staff, PHPA Consultants, and Legal Advisors. Meeting called to order 8:45am. Introductions & Opening Remarks – Larry Landon, PHPA Executive Director Larry welcomed all Player Representatives to Orlando and said that this week’s meetings will be an educational experience as 50% in attendance are first-time attendees. He encouraged Reps to ask questions throughout the week. Hopefully players will leave with a greater understanding of the Association allowing them to educate and assist their teammates. Larry then congratulated the ECHL Kelly Cup and Central Hockey League President’s Cup winners. (At the time, the AHL Calder Cup Playoffs were still in progress) Larry mentioned the special guests who will be in attendance this week and noted the importance of raising concerns to each League’s Commissioner / President during their breakout session, ensuring they are aware of any issues which impact players. Robert’s Rules of Order were briefly reviewed. As required by the Department of Labor and Association’s Auditors, minutes will be taken throughout the meetings. As such, Players were asked to speak one at a time and to state their name when asking questions. Larry explained the role of the Executive Committee where members receive Association financials every 90 days and are actively involved in the decision making process. Executive Committee Meeting Report - Maxime Fortunus, Executive Committee Member Larry introduced Max Fortunus from the Executive Committee to review items discussed during yesterday’s Executive Committee meeting. Max explained that much of the meeting had to do with the uncertainty surrounding the Central Hockey League. -
